What Is Dermaplaning?
Dermaplaning is a professional exfoliation treatment that uses a sterile surgical blade to gently remove dead skin cells and fine facial hair, often called peach fuzz, from the surface of the skin.
The treatment leaves the skin feeling exceptionally smooth and allows skincare products to penetrate more effectively. It also creates a flawless canvas for makeup application.
Unlike harsh treatments that require recovery time, dermaplaning is quick, comfortable, and suitable for most people.
How Much Does Dermaplaning Cost in Tucson?
The cost of dermaplaning Tucson treatments can vary depending on the spa, provider experience, and whether the treatment is combined with other skincare services.
Typically, dermaplaning sessions range from $75 to $150 per treatment. Some spas offer package pricing or combine dermaplaning with customized facials for enhanced results.
While prices vary, many clients consider dermaplaning a worthwhile investment due to the immediate improvement in skin appearance and texture.
Benefits of Dermaplaning
Smoother Skin Texture
One of the most noticeable benefits is smoother skin. By removing the buildup of dead skin cells, dermaplaning instantly improves texture and softness.
Brighter Complexion
Dull skin often results from accumulated dead skin on the surface. Dermaplaning reveals fresh skin underneath, creating a brighter, more radiant appearance.
Better Product Absorption
After treatment, serums, moisturizers, and other skincare products can penetrate the skin more effectively, maximizing their benefits.
Improved Makeup Application
Many clients love dermaplaning because foundation and makeup glide on more smoothly without catching on peach fuzz or uneven skin texture.
Non-Invasive Treatment
Unlike more aggressive procedures, dermaplaning requires no needles, chemicals, or recovery time, making it a convenient option for busy individuals.
What Results Can You Expect?
Most people notice immediate results after their first appointment. Skin typically appears:
- Smoother
- Brighter
- More even in texture
- Softer to the touch
Results generally last about three to four weeks, depending on your skin's natural renewal cycle.
Regular treatments can help maintain a consistently refreshed and healthy-looking complexion.

Who Is Dermaplaning Best For?
Dermaplaning is suitable for many individuals, especially those who want to improve:
- Dull skin
- Rough texture
- Mild acne scarring
- Dry or flaky skin
- Uneven makeup application
It's also a popular treatment before weddings, vacations, and special events because it provides instant skin-smoothing benefits.
Who Should Avoid Dermaplaning?
Although dermaplaning is safe for most people, it may not be ideal for those with:
- Active acne breakouts
- Open wounds or skin infections
- Certain inflammatory skin conditions
A professional consultation can help determine whether dermaplaning is appropriate for your skin.
How Often Should You Get Dermaplaning?
Most skincare professionals recommend scheduling dermaplaning every 3–4 weeks. This timing aligns with the skin's natural cell turnover cycle and helps maintain optimal results.
Regular treatments can support healthier skin and improve the effectiveness of your overall skincare routine.
Common Myths About Dermaplaning
Will Hair Grow Back Thicker?
No. One of the most common misconceptions is that dermaplaning causes facial hair to grow back thicker or darker. The hair grows back with the same texture and color as before.
Is Dermaplaning Painful?
Not at all. Most clients describe the sensation as a gentle scraping or brushing feeling. The treatment is generally comfortable and relaxing.
Is There Downtime?
No. One of the biggest advantages of dermaplaning is that there is virtually no downtime. You can return to normal activities immediately after your appointment.
